吸烟检测方法、系统、设备及介质技术方案

技术编号:35214806 阅读:19 留言:0更新日期:2022-10-15 10:29
本申请提出了一种吸烟检测方法、系统、设备及介质,该方法包括:获取各个角度的人脸图像与待融合目标物图像,对所述人脸图像与所述待融合目标物图像进行融合处理,得到吸烟图像,将所述吸烟图像与非吸烟图像构成数据集;基于所述数据集建立神经网络模型,进行训练,得到吸烟检测模型;获取待测的目标检测视频,将所述目标检测视频的目标图像输入所述吸烟检测模型进行检测,得到预测概率;根据所述目标图像的预测概率确定所述目标检测视频的吸烟结果,通过以多个角度的人脸图像为基础将待融合目标物图像进行融合处理,得到丰富数据集,通过该数据集训练得到烟检测模型大大提高了吸烟检测的准确度、泛化能力、以及场景迁移的通用能力。的通用能力。的通用能力。

【技术实现步骤摘要】
吸烟检测方法、系统、设备及介质


[0001]本申请涉及视频监控或图像处理领域,尤其涉及一种吸烟检测方法、系统、设备及介质。

技术介绍

[0002]吸烟有害健康,尤其在公共环境下吸烟会造成的如下危害:污染公共场合的空气,造成他人被动吸烟;随意丢弃烟头,若碰到公共场合的易燃易爆物品,容易造成火灾。因现在还有很多公民没有主动遵守公共管理准则,还需要人力去巡检,进行吸烟检测,必然需要投入大量的人力物力。随着人工智能的快速发展,越来越多的深度学习算法应用在解决公共环境下的吸烟检测上。
[0003]现有的吸烟检测算法中,有的是基于图像直接进行吸烟检测判断,通过检测算法判断图片中是否有点燃的香烟,主要使用的检测算法有目标检测SSD(Single Shot MultiBox Detector) 算法、Faster RCNN(Regions with CNN features)算法以及YOLO(You Only Look Once)算法等,如果判断出有点燃的香烟,就进行吸烟提示报警。然而,现有的数据集在训练检测模型时,由于数据集单一,造成该检测模型在实际应用场景中检测精度较低,无法满足车辆行驶中对驾驶员抽烟行为准确检测。
[0004]申请内容
[0005]鉴于以上所述现有技术的缺点,本申请提供一种吸烟检测方法、系统、设备及介质,以解决上述技术问题。
[0006]本申请提供的一种吸烟检测方法,所述方法包括:
[0007]获取各个角度的人脸图像与待融合目标物图像,所述待融合目标物图像包括香烟图像、烟雾图像、手持香烟图像中的至少之一;
[0008]对所述人脸图像与所述待融合目标物图像进行融合处理,得到吸烟图像;将所述吸烟图像和非吸烟图像构成数据集;
[0009]基于所述数据集建立神经网络模型,进行训练,得到吸烟检测模型;
[0010]获取待测的目标检测视频,将所述目标检测视频的目标图像输入所述吸烟检测模型进行检测,得到预测概率;根据所述目标图像的预测概率确定所述目标检测视频的吸烟结果,其中,所述目标图像为所述目标检测视频中目标人物的人脸图像。
[0011]在一种可能的实施方式中,对所述人脸图像与所述待融合目标物图像进行融合处理,得到吸烟图像,包括:
[0012]对所述人脸图像的角度进行计算,确定人脸姿态旋转角,其中,利用不同的所述人脸姿态旋转角来表征各个角度;
[0013]根据所述人脸图像的人脸姿态旋转角确定待融合目标物图像投影至所述人脸图像的投影位置、投影大小与投影角度;
[0014]按照所述投影大小与所述投影角度对所述待融合目标物图像进行仿射变换,确定变换后的待融合目标物图像;
[0015]根据所述投影位置与所述投影角度将所述待融合目标物图像添加到所述人脸图像进行合并处理,得到吸烟图像;和,将所述人脸图像中不含待融合目标物的图像确定为非吸烟图像。
[0016]在一种可能的实施方式中,根据所述投影位置与所述投影角度将所述待融合目标物图像添加到所述人脸图像进行合并处理之前,还包括:
[0017]对所述人脸图像中嘴部区域的模糊度进行计算,得到嘴部像素值;
[0018]根据所述嘴部像素值调节所述待融合目标物图像的像素点,直到所述待融合目标物图像的模糊度与嘴部区域的模糊度相同为止。
[0019]在一种可能的实施方式中,根据所述人脸图像的人脸姿态旋转角确定待融合目标物图像投影至所述人脸图像的投影位置、投影大小与投影角度,还包括:
[0020]所述人脸姿态旋转角为三维旋转角,所述三维旋转角包括绕X轴旋转的导向角、绕Y轴旋转的俯视角、绕Z轴旋转的翻滚角;
[0021]利用所述人脸图像的三维旋转角确定待融合目标物图像投影至二维的目标图像中投影位置、投影大小与投影角度。
[0022]在一种可能的实施方式中,按照所述投影大小与所述投影角度对所述待融合目标物图像进行仿射变换,确定变换后的待融合目标物图像,还包括:
[0023]依据所述投影大小对所述待融合目标物图像进行缩放处理,得到缩放后的待融合目标物图像;
[0024]按照所述投影大小与所述投影角度对缩放后的所述待融合目标物图像进行仿射变换,得到变换后的待融合目标物图像。
[0025]在一种可能的实施方式中,根据所述投影位置与所述投影角度将所述待融合目标物图像添加到所述人脸图像进行合并处理,得到吸烟图像,还包括:
[0026]根据所述人脸图像的人脸关键点与嘴部区域关键点计算人脸图像与待融合目标物图像的融合区域;
[0027]以所述人脸图像为背景且所述待融合目标物图像为前景,在所述融合区域所对应的位置坐标进行加权融合,得到合并处理的吸烟图像;
[0028]对合并处理的所述吸烟图像中的目标物轮廓进行羽化处理,得到最终的吸烟图像。
[0029]在一种可能的实施方式中,基于所述数据集建立神经网络模型,进行训练,得到吸烟检测模型,包括:
[0030]将所述数据集按比例划分为训练集、测试集与验证集;
[0031]构建神经网络模型,所述神经网络模型为Yolov5网络模型;所述Yolov5网络模型基于 FPN+PAN结构来提取烟点特征;其中,利用FPN结构提取不同尺度的特征图,所述特征图至少包括第一特征图、第二特征图与第三特征图,将所述第一特征图的一次上采样至第二特征图的大小;将一次上采样的第二特征图与原有第二特征图融合后再进行二次上采样,与原有第三特征图进行融合,得到预测的第三特征图,从上至下依次进行上采样传递融合;利用PAN 结构将所述第三特征图的一次下采样至第二特征图的大小;将一次下采样的第二特征图与原有第二特征图融合后再进行二次下采样,与原有第一特征图进行融合,得到预测的第一特征图,从下至上传递定位特征。
[0032]利用所述训练集的样本数据提取的烟点特征对Yolov5网络模型进行训练,得到吸烟检测模型;
[0033]利用所述测试集与验证集的样本数据分别对吸烟检测模型进行测试与验证,得到最终的吸烟检测模型。
[0034]本申请还提供了一种吸烟检测系统,所述系统包括:
[0035]获取模块,获取各个角度的人脸图像与待融合目标物图像,所述待融合目标物图像包括香烟图像、烟雾图像、手持香烟图像中的至少之一;
[0036]数据集生成模块,对所述人脸图像与所述待融合目标物图像进行融合处理,得到吸烟图像;将所述吸烟图像和非吸烟图像构成数据集;
[0037]模型构建模块,基于所述数据集建立神经网络模型,进行训练,得到吸烟检测模型;
[0038]吸烟检测模块,用于获取待测的目标检测视频,将所述目标检测视频的目标图像输入所述吸烟检测模型进行检测,得到预测概率;根据所述目标图像的预测概率确定所述目标检测视频的吸烟结果,其中,所述目标图像为所述目标检测视频中目标人物的人脸图像。
[0039]本申请还提供了一种电子设备,包括处理器、存储器和通信总线;
[0040]所述通信本文档来自技高网
...

【技术保护点】

【技术特征摘要】
1.一种吸烟检测方法,其特征在于,所述方法包括:获取各个角度的人脸图像与待融合目标物图像,所述待融合目标物图像包括香烟图像、烟雾图像、手持香烟图像中的至少之一;对所述人脸图像与所述待融合目标物图像进行融合处理,得到吸烟图像;将所述吸烟图像和非吸烟图像构成数据集;基于所述数据集建立神经网络模型,进行训练,得到吸烟检测模型;获取待测的目标检测视频,将所述目标检测视频的目标图像输入所述吸烟检测模型进行检测,得到预测概率;根据所述目标图像的预测概率确定所述目标检测视频的吸烟结果,其中,所述目标图像为所述目标检测视频中目标人物的人脸图像。2.如权利要求1所述的方法,其特征在于,对所述人脸图像与所述待融合目标物图像进行融合处理,得到吸烟图像,包括:对所述人脸图像的角度进行计算,确定人脸姿态旋转角,其中,利用不同的所述人脸姿态旋转角来表征各个角度;根据所述人脸图像的人脸姿态旋转角确定待融合目标物图像投影至所述人脸图像的投影位置、投影大小与投影角度;按照所述投影大小与所述投影角度对所述待融合目标物图像进行仿射变换,确定变换后的待融合目标物图像;根据所述投影位置与所述投影角度将所述待融合目标物图像添加到所述人脸图像进行合并处理,得到吸烟图像;和,将所述人脸图像中不含待融合目标物的图像确定为非吸烟图像。3.如权利要求2所述的方法,其特征在于,根据所述投影位置与所述投影角度将所述待融合目标物图像添加到所述人脸图像进行合并处理之前,还包括:对所述人脸图像中嘴部区域的模糊度进行计算,得到嘴部像素值;根据所述嘴部像素值调节所述待融合目标物图像的像素点,直到所述待融合目标物图像的模糊度与嘴部区域的模糊度相同为止。4.如权利要求3所述的方法,其特征在于,根据所述人脸图像的人脸姿态旋转角确定待融合目标物图像投影至所述人脸图像的投影位置、投影大小与投影角度,还包括:所述人脸姿态旋转角为三维旋转角,所述三维旋转角包括绕X轴旋转的导向角、绕Y轴旋转的俯视角、绕Z轴旋转的翻滚角;利用所述人脸图像的三维旋转角确定待融合目标物图像投影至二维的目标图像中投影位置、投影大小与投影角度。5.如权利要求2至4任一所述的方法,其特征在于,按照所述投影大小与所述投影角度对所述待融合目标物图像进行仿射变换,确定变换后的待融合目标物图像,还包括:依据所述投影大小对所述待融合目标物图像进行缩放处理,得到缩放后的待融合目标物图像;按照所述投影大小与所述投影角度对缩放后的所述待融合目标物图像进行仿射变换,得到变换后的待融合目标物图像。6.如权利要求2至4任一所述的方法,其特征在于,根据所述投影位置与所述投影角度将所述待融合目标物图像添加到所述人脸图像进行合并处理,得到吸烟图像,还...

【专利技术属性】
技术研发人员:黄羽
申请(专利权)人:重庆紫光华山智安科技有限公司
类型:发明
国别省市:

网友询问留言 已有0条评论
  • 还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。

1